mkapi-fix-coz
A fork of mkapi-fix to fit our needs and gives publishing control. Without publishing controls we will get
Invalid value for requires_dist. Error: Can't have direct dependency:
when trying to publish to PyPi with a dependency based on a Git commit hash. The reason is as per this description
Public index servers SHOULD NOT allow the use of direct references in uploaded distributions. Direct references are intended as a tool for software integrators rather than publishers.
as described here https://peps.python.org/pep-0440/#direct-references
Install
pip install mkapi-fix-coz
